Research Article: Genomic Analysis of Carbapenem-Resistant Hypervirulent Klebsiella pneumoniae in a Chinese Tertiary Hospital
Abstract:
Klebsiella pneumoniae (KP) is a common opportunistic pathogen in clinical practice, capable of causing infectious diseases in the urinary tract, respiratory tract, blood, and soft tissues. Hypervirulent Klebsiella pneumoniae (hvKp) has a higher virulence than KP and can cause severe infectious diseases, including pyogenic liver abscess, endophthalmitis, and meningitis.,
